What is the color code for Green Smoke?

Hex color code for Green Smoke color is #9ab27a. RGB color code for green smoke color is rgb(154, 178, 122).

What is the RGB value of #9ab27a?

The RGB value corresponding to the hexadecimal color code #9ab27a is rgb(154, 178, 122). These values represent the intensities of the red, green, and blue components of the color, respectively. Here, '154' indicates the intensity of the red component, '178' represents the green component's intensity, and '122' denotes the blue component's intensity. Combined in these specific proportions, these three color components create the color represented by #9ab27a.

What does RGB 154,178,122 mean?

The RGB color 154, 178, 122 represents a dull and muted shade of Green. The websafe version of this color is hex 999966. This color might be commonly referred to as a shade similar to Green Smoke.
